Joe has a collection of nickels and dimes that is worth $2.15.
If the number of dimes was doubled and the number of nickels was increased by 28, the value of the coins would be $4.65.
How many nickels and dimes does he have?
:
Let n = no. of nickels
Let d = no. of dimes
:
Write an equation for each scenario
:
"Joe has a collection of nickels and dimes that is worth $2.15."
.05n + .10d = 2.15
:
" If the number of dimes was doubled and the number of nickels was increased by 28, the value of the coins would be $4.65. "
.05(n+28) + .10(2d) = 4.64
.05n + 1.40 + .20d = 4.65
.05n + .20d = 4.65 - 1.40
.05n + .20d = 3.25
.05n + .10d = 2.15; subtract the 1st equation, from the above
------------------- eliminates n, find d
.10d = 1.10
d = 1.10%2F.10
d = 11 dimes
Find the nickels
.05n + .10(11) = 2.15
.05n + 1.10 = 2.15
.05n = 2.15 - 1.10
.05n = 1.05
n = 1.05%2F.05
n = 21 nickels
:
ans: 21 nickels, 11 dimes
